Output 2663da60d6299efd8500d7e26d7895850e32b449f2a52c62968cee652e49569f:32

value
1089300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f0ec73d6cb87b4a6c8478fdbef9f3d00236ef4 OP_EQUAL
address
3PHr1V23HJoHuDaXhXFJ5j2X3LZqgyutEZ
transaction
2663da60d6299efd8500d7e26d7895850e32b449f2a52c62968cee652e49569f
spent
true